This location of regulation includes a broad range of services Visit This Link and duties, all tailored towards aiding clients shield their assets, minimize tax obligation liabilities, and ensure their wishes are performed effectively. Among the main roles of an estate lawyer is to aid customers in producing thorough estate plans. This includes preparing wills, trusts, and other lawful files that synopsis just how a person's possessions ought to be dispersed upon their fatality.




When somebody passes away, their estate typically more info here goes via a legal process recognized as probate. Estate lawyers play a crucial role in guiding their customers' estates via this procedure.


Beyond the distribution of properties, estate lawyers additionally assist clients prepare for unanticipated scenarios. This can entail the creation of powers of lawyer, healthcare instructions, and guardianship arrangements for small kids. These files make sure that individuals are protected and their rate of interests are stood for if they become incapacitated or unable to choose by themselves.
